##Introduction to XYO and Its Vision

XYO is a blockchain-based protocol designed to collect, verify, and utilize geospatial data without relying on centralized authorities. It enables devices—referred to as "sentinels" and "bridges"—to securely and trustlessly collect and transmit location information.

The main vision behind XYO is to establish a decentralized data marketplace where users can monetize location-based data while ensuring privacy and accuracy. For crypto investors and blockchain developers, XYO represents a blockchain innovation application that goes beyond financial transactions.

##How the XYO Blockchain Network Works

Essentially, the XYO network relies on four fundamental components:

1. Sentinel – A device that observes and collects location information, such as GPS coordinates.

2. Bridge – The gateway that transfers data from the sentinel to the blockchain.

3. Archive Administrator – A node that stores and indexes data for future use.

**4. Diviner$$ – A node that analyzes and verifies data to ensure accuracy.

By combining these elements, XYO has created a self-sustaining ecosystem in which data can be verified without relying on centralized sources, making it resistant to manipulation.

Use Cases of XYO in Real-World Applications

The potential applications of XYO are extensive, covering multiple industries:

  • Supply Chain and Logistics – Real-time tracking of goods to ensure authenticity and prevent fraud.
  • E-commerce – Verify package delivery without relying on third-party tracking systems.
  • Insurance - Confirm asset location to process claims.
  • Smart Cities - Powering IoT devices that require accurate and verifiable geospatial data.

By enabling these use cases, XYO opens up new possibilities for blockchain applications beyond the financial industry.
